在传统的数据库管理系统中,分区是一个必不可少的功能,能够帮助提高性能并更好地组织和管理数据。而在最新的PostgreSQL 11版本中,引入了声明式分区的功能,使得分区管理变得更加简单和灵活。

声明式分区是一种新的分区策略,可以通过简单的语法来定义分区规则,而不需手动创建分区函数和触发器。这一特性使得在PostgreSQL中实现分区更加容易,同时提高了代码的可维护性和可读性。

通过声明式分区,用户可以轻松地在表上定义分区规则,使得数据在多个分区之间自动进行划分。这样一来,便可以将数据按照特定的条件进行存储和查询,提升了查询的效率和可扩展性。

除了简化了分区规则的定义,声明式分区还提供了更好的性能优化和更方便的数据管理功能。用户可以通过声明式分区来有效地管理大型数据集,实现更快速且更可靠的数据存储和查询。

总的来说,PostgreSQL中的声明式分区功能为用户提供了一种更加简单和高效的数据管理方式。无论是对于大型企业数据库还是小型应用程序,声明式分区都能够帮助用户更好地管理和优化数据库性能,是PostgreSQL数据库管理的一个重要利器。

详情参考

了解更多有趣的事情:https://blog.ds3783.com/